With the 2009 opening of the Dubai Fountain, featured in today"s image, the city of Dubai claimed another record for the books—"world"s tallest performing fountain.’ It"s located appropriately enough at the foot of the Burj Khalifa, currently the world"s tallest building. Designed by the same company that created the fountains at the Bellagio Hotel in Las Vegas, everything about the Dubai Fountain is impressive. Over 900 feet long and located in the 30-acre Burj Lake, the fountain has more than 6,600 lights and 75 color projectors. These are used to create over 1,000 different "water expressions" and provide a rainbow of colors, all perfectly choreographed to a carefully crafted musical playlist.
